Energy levels: 1s1/2, 2p1/2, 2p3/2, 3d3/2, and 3d5/2 of the muon in the spherical nuclei:120Sn,197Au and208Pb have been calculated under the assumption of harmonic oscillator potential. The levels are corrected for vacuum polarisation. The agreement with experimental values is better than 0·5%. An accurate method of solving the Dirac equation to obtain the energy eigenvalues is outlined. The importance of choosing the ‘classical turning point’ as the radius for matching the interior and exterior solutions is discussed.
